In the small water gas production of ammonia plant, the proportion of nitrogen to hydrogen ratio is table after adding the nitrogen, which smooths the operation and reduce  the consumption of synthetic ammonia; In addition, it also use the refined nitrogen (99.99%) to protect the catalyst; With pure liquid nitrogen washing refined Hydrogen and nitrogen mixture, so that the inert gas (methane and hydrogen) is extremely small, the contact of carbon monoxide and oxygen are no more than 20PPm. The consumption of nitrogen wash and nitrogen are about 750m3/t ammonia. In the chemical plant, nitrogen is mainly for the protection of gas, ventilation and washing gas, to ensure safe production. Such as polypropylene production, it need to use pure nitrogen (99.99%) functioning as the protection of gas, replacement gas. High purity nitrogen is a vital source of chemical fiber production. Such as Liaoyang Petrochemical Plant has three sets of 3000 m 3 / hour high purity nitrogen device;Synthetic leather factory also use high purity nitrogen to do protection, such as Yantai synthetic leather factory has a 1000m3/hour high purity nitrogen device. On 15th June, 2015, the liquid oxygen plant KDO-200Y designed and manufactured by our company had successful trial run in Shangri-La, Tibet. This is the first oxygen plant in Tibet area, which can supply gas oxygen for Shangri-La city residents centralized.
